    Assuming you’re referring to your .com domain, you can absolutely transfer it to WordPress.com. When you upgrade to a yearly WordPress.com plan, you get a free domain credit that’s valid for the first year. You can use that credit to transfer the domain to WordPress.com. We’ll renew the domain for a year after the transfer is completed.

    From the next year onwards, both the WordPress.com Personal plan and the domain registration will renew with separate fees.
